HIP 86706

HIP 86706 is a A-type (White) star located in the constellation Hercules.

Located approximately 633.3 light-years from Earth, HIP 86706 res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.

HIP 86706 is classified as a spectral class A star (A-type (White)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.

HIP 86706 has an apparent magnitude of +8.49,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its blue-white h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+0.287.
